I'm using a ifi zen dac v2 for my Hifiman Edition XS and Sennheiser HD560s and as a dac for my NAD 3020A powering a pair of Boston Acoustics A40 bookshelf speakers. For a mic I'm using a fifine T669.

Even though these speakers and amp are almost 40 years old their sound is on par with a HD 560s with some EQ to tone down the warmth

Went back and forth on sound, and kept sticking to the Logitech speakers, headsets etc.

Just never satisfied.

Then just took the plunge and bought Edifier speakers, and a Polk audio 10" sub, connected through my computer's SPDIF - Still need to get a sound card to improve the output

Polk audio psw10
Edifier R1280DBs

Since I've installed this, music is pure bliss! I'm amazed at the sound quality compared to "computer speaker" sets like Logitech's kit.

I can hardly push the volume past the 40% mark(It's just to loud and the bass shakes the room). I'd advise anyone to rather invest in a similar set
